    converting regular odds to asian handicapping odds?
    If I have calculated that the fair odds for under2.5 goals in a soccer match is 1.75 (decimal odds) but the bookie only offers a line over/under 2.25 goals. How do I relate the odds?

    2.25 is half the bet at the 2.5 line, which you already have, and half the bet at 2 goals. Thus, you need the probabilities for u1.5 also.
